打造高效Excel服务器教程

如何制作excel服务器

时间:2024-11-16 04:30


如何高效制作Excel服务器 在当今数字化时代,数据管理和分析对于企业和组织至关重要

    Excel作为一款强大的数据处理工具,广泛应用于各个行业

    然而,随着数据量的不断增长和团队协作需求的增加,传统的单机版Excel已难以满足需求

    搭建Excel服务器可以实现数据的集中存储、共享和高效处理,提升工作效率和数据准确性

    本文将详细介绍如何高效制作Excel服务器,包括选择服务器平台、安装操作系统和应用程序、配置服务器、开发自定义应用程序等关键步骤

     一、选择适合的服务器平台 制作Excel服务器的第一步是选择一个适合的服务器平台

    常见的选择包括Windows Server和Linux

    你需要根据你的需求和熟悉程度来选择最适合的平台

     - Windows Server:如果你的团队熟悉Windows环境,且已有相关的技术支持,Windows Server是一个不错的选择

    Windows Server提供了良好的兼容性和易用性,能够很好地支持Microsoft Office套件,包括Excel

     - Linux:如果你的团队更倾向于开源解决方案,或者需要更高的灵活性,Linux是一个值得考虑的选项

    Linux平台可以通过Wine等工具来运行Excel,尽管可能需要一些额外的配置和调试

     二、安装服务器操作系统 根据选择的服务器平台,安装相应的操作系统

    例如,如果选择了Windows Server,你需要安装Windows Server操作系统;如果选择了Linux,你需要安装一个合适的Linux发行版,如Ubuntu、CentOS等

     - Windows Server:安装过程相对简单,可以通过微软的官方网站下载ISO文件,并使用光盘或U盘启动进行安装

    在安装过程中,需要配置网络设置、域和组策略等

     - Linux:Linux的安装过程可能稍复杂一些,但通常也提供了详细的安装指南

    你需要选择适合你的需求的Linux发行版,并按照其安装文档进行安装

     三、安装Excel应用程序 在你的服务器上安装Excel应用程序是制作Excel服务器的关键步骤之一

     - Windows Server:如果你使用的是Windows Server操作系统,可以直接安装Microsoft Office套件,其中包括Excel

    安装过程相对简单,只需按照安装向导进行操作即可

     - Linux:如果你选择的是Linux平台,可以考虑使用Wine等工具来运行Excel

    Wine是一个开源的兼容层,可以在Linux上运行Windows应用程序

    虽然Wine能够运行Excel,但可能需要一些调试和配置,以确保其稳定性和性能

     四、配置服务器 配置服务器是确保Excel服务器能够安全、高效地运行的关键

    你需要根据你的需求,配置服务器的网络设置、安全设置和性能设置等

     - 网络设置:配置服务器的IP地址、子网掩码、默认网关和DNS服务器等网络参数,确保服务器能够连接到网络,并允许远程用户访问

     - 安全设置:配置防火墙、设置远程访问策略、创建用户账户和角色,并分配不同的权限级别(如只读、编辑或审批等)

    这些设置有助于保护服务器免受潜在的攻击和数据泄露

     - 性能设置:根据服务器的硬件资源和预期的用户负载,配置服务器的内存分配、CPU使用、磁盘I/O等性能参数,以确保服务器在高负载下的稳定性和响应速度

     五、配置远程访问 如果你希望通过远程访问使用Excel服务器,你需要配置服务器以允许远程用户连接

    这可能涉及到配置防火墙、设置远程桌面连接、FTP或WebDAV等访问方式

     - 防火墙配置:在防火墙中打开必要的端口,以允许远程用户访问Excel服务器

    例如,如果你使用远程桌面连接,你需要打开3389端口;如果你使用WebDAV,你需要打开80或443端口

     - 远程桌面连接:配置远程桌面连接,允许远程用户通过远程桌面协议(RDP)连接到服务器

    这可以通过Windows Server的远程桌面设置或Linux的VNC等工具来实现

     - FTP或WebDAV:配置FTP或WebDAV服务器,允许用户通过文件传输协议(FTP)或WebDAV协议上传和下载Excel文件

    这可以通过Windows Server的IIS(Internet Information Services)或Linux的Apache、Nginx等Web服务器来实现

     六、开发自定义应用程序(可选) 根据你的需求,你可能需要开发自定义的应用程序来管理和使用Excel服务器

    这可以通过使用编程语言如C、Java等来实现,或者使用脚本语言如Python等

     - 使用编程语言:你可以使用C# 、Java等编程语言开发自定义的应用程序,这些应用程序可以与Excel服务器进行交互,实现数据的导入、导出、查询和报表生成等功能

     - 使用脚本语言:Python等脚本语言也可以用于开发自定义的应用程序

    Python提供了丰富的库和工具,可以方便地处理Excel文件和与服务器进行通信

     七、安装Excel Server软件(另一种方案) 除了直接在服务器上安装Excel应用程序外,你还可以选择安装专门的Excel Server软件,如Microsoft Office Online Server或Office Web Apps

    这些软件允许你通过服务器访问和编辑Excel文件

     - 选择软件:根据你的需求和预算,选择一个适合的Excel Server软件

    Microsoft Office Online Server和Office Web Apps是常见的选择,它们提供了良好的兼容性和易用性

     - 下载并安装:下载并安装选择的Excel Server软件

    安装过程通常包括安装软件、配置服务器环境和设置安全性设置等步骤

     - 配置服务器环境:配置服务器的域名、IP地址和端口号等网络参数

    通过DNS管理工具将域名指向服务器的IP地址

     - 设置安全性设置:配置访问权限、验证机制和防火墙等安全性设置,以保护Excel服务器免受潜在的攻击和数据泄露

     八、创建用户账户和分配权限 在Excel服务器上创建用户账户,并根据需要分配不同的权限

    这可以通过在服务器上创建用户账户和角色来实现

     - 创建用户账户:在服务器上创建用户账户,为每个用户分配一个唯一的用户名和密码

     - 分配权限:根据用户的需求和角色,分配不同的权限级别

    例如,你可以为某些用户分配只读权限,而为其他用户分配编辑或审批权限

     九、共享Excel文件 将Excel文件共享到服务器上,以使多个用